About Unbabel

The company’s language operations platform blends advanced artificial intelligence with human editors, for fast, efficient, high-quality translations that get smarter over time. Unbabel integrates seamlessly in any channel so that agents can deliver consistent multilingual support from within their existing workflows. Making it easy for enterprises to grow into new markets and build seamless customer experiences in every corner of the world.

Based in San Francisco, California, Unbabel works with leading customer support and marketing teams at brands such as Facebook, Microsoft, Booking.com, and Under Armour to communicate effortlessly with customers around the world, no matter what language they speak.

Responsibilities

  • Providing executive, administrative, and development support to the Leadership Team and, when required, to the CEO and CTO (on a case by case basis).
  • Acting as the primary point of contact for both internal and external stakeholders on all matters relating to the Leadership Team and acting as liaison to the Board of Directors and other senior staff.
  • Managing information flow on a daily basis in a timely and accurate manner.Managing the Leadership Team calendars and appointments, setting up meetings and compiling any agenda and documentary requirements.
  • Managing the Leadership Team complex travel and logistics.
  • Managing Leadership Team written correspondence - reading, responding and delegating as appropriate.
  • Planning and executing executive events, including leadership team off-sites and meetings of the Board of Directors.
  • Preparing research and drafts of documents, proposals and presentations for the Leadership Team.
  • Completing a broad variety of daily administrative tasks, including payments and expense reports.
  • Running personal errands and tasks for the Leadership Team as may be required.
  • Serve as the backup for the current Executive Assistant, demonstrating flexibility to cover all shifts as needed.
